Educational, vocational, and social inclusion is one of the fundamental principles that ensure people with disabilities a chance to have as a normal life as possible. In turn, accessibility is one of the most important components of inclusion and could be defined as the right of people with disabilities to benefit of the same products and services as all other community members. According to government data from 2015, in Romania 752 931 were people with disabilities, 60 289 were children and 13.9% had various forms of visual impairment. For these people, any limitation in accessibility means isolation and discrimination. On the other hand, education and new technologies can increase the accessibility of people with visual impairment to quality products and services in society. Therefore, the purpose of this research was the identification of attitude and training level of teachers in the educational process accessibility for students with visual impairment using ICT. The sample consisted of 210 professors who teach in pre-academic learning system in Bihor, Romania and research tool - a questionnaire composed of 76 multiple choice items – it was administered online by the end of 2016. The results of the research show that, even if they want to support inclusion of people with visual impairment using ICT in teaching/learning, most teachers do not have professional skills in that field and do not know how to use educational software or to adapt a scholar curriculum for this category of students. Keywords: accessibility; educational inclusion; new Technology;

This quantitative research aims to analyze the impact of the WampServer application in Blended learning during the educational process of computing through data science, machine learning, and neural networks. WampServer is a free application that allows the creation of websites considering the use of the database. This research proposes the use of Blended learning in the Development of applications subject in order to facilitate the teaching–learning process in the Database unit. The students discuss and reflect the concepts on the database in the classroom and carry out various school activities on the construction of websites at home through the use of the WampServer application. The sample consists of 28 students who took the Development of applications subject during the 2016 school year. The results of machine learning (linear regression) with 50, 60, and 70% of training indicate that the use of PHP, HTML, and SQL languages in the WampServer application positively influences the assimilation of knowledge and development of skills on web programming. Data science identifies six predictive models about the use of WampServer in the educational process of computing. On the other hand, neural networks determine the factors that influence the assimilation of knowledge and development of skills on web programming. This research recommends the incorporation of the WampServer application in the school activities related to the computer field to create new educational spaces and facilitate the teaching–learning process. Teachers can transform the educational context through the organization and realization of creative activities inside and outside the classroom. Finally, the use of WampServer in Blended learning allows creating new spaces for teaching and learning of computer science because this application favors the assimilation of knowledge and development of skills on web programming.

The experience of organizing the educational process during the quarantine caused by the COVID-19 pandemic is considered. Using of interactive technologies that allow organizing instant audio communication with a remote audience, as well as intelligent tools based on artificial intelligence that can help educational institutions to work more efficiently. Examples of sufficient use of artificial intelligence in distance learning are given. Particular attention is paid to the development of intelligent chatbots intended for use in communications with students of online courses of educational web portals. The use of technologies of ontology formation based on automatic extraction of concepts from external sources is offered, what can lead to greater acceleration of construction of the intellectual component of chatbots. Artificial intelligence tools can become an essential part of distance learning during this global COVID-19 pandemic. While educational institutions are closed to quarantine and many of them transitioned to distance learning lecturers and schoolteachers, as well as students and schoolchildren faced with the necessity to study in this new reality. The impact of these changes depends on people's ability to learn and on the role that the education system will play in meeting the demand for quality and affordable training. The experience of organizing the educational process at the University of Education Management of the National Academy of Pedagogical Sciences of Ukraine in the quarantine caused by the COVID-19 pandemic showed that higher and postgraduate institutions were mostly ready to move to distance learning. However, most distance learning systems, on whatever platform they are organized, need to be supplemented: the ability to broadcast video (at least ‒ one-way streaming), providing fast transmission of various types of information, receiving instant feedback when voting, polls and more. The structure of each section of the training course for the online learning system should fully cover the training material and meet all the objectives of the course. Appropriate language should be used, and wording, syntax, and presentation of tasks should be considered.
